The AGO Auf Deutsch card game helps beginners practice German conversation through a question-and-answer format. It includes 54 playing cards—36 question cards with simple, useful German questions and 18 action cards—printed on 300gsm linen-finish stock. Each question card features custom illustrations and labeled vocabulary to support understanding. The game is designed for learners who want to build confidence asking and answering questions in German, and the graded questions introduce language structures progressively. An instruction booklet is included.

What’s Inside the Deck?

  • 36 question cards with everyday German questions and vocabulary illustrations
  • 18 action cards that add variety and allow classic card game play
  • Instruction booklet with game rules and suggestions

How Does the Game Help You Learn German?

Players take turns drawing question cards and answering them in German. The labeled images on each card provide context, making it easier to remember new words. Action cards introduce twists like swapping questions or skipping turns, keeping the game lively. Because learners both ask and answer questions, they get balanced practice of speaking and listening. The questions are carefully graded, starting simple and gradually increasing in complexity, which helps build a foundation for further studies.

Is This Game Suitable for Complete Beginners?

Yes, the game is designed for beginners. The questions are simple and relate to everyday topics such as hobbies, family, and daily routines. The included vocabulary labels and illustrations offer visual support, and the instruction booklet explains how to play in clear steps. However, players should already know basic German phrases to get the most benefit; the game reinforces what learners have started studying.
